What Color Kitchen Cabinets With White Appliances?

When considering what color kitchen cabinets to pair with white appliances, there are several options. Depending on your personal style, desired level of contrast, and budget, you can choose from a variety of colors and materials.

One of the most popular options is dark-toned wood cabinets. These cabinets provide a timeless look that will never go out of style. The contrast between the white appliances and the dark wood create a beautiful juxtaposition that is perfect for modern or traditional kitchen designs. You can also choose from several shades of wood to achieve the exact look you’re going for.

If you’re looking for something more contemporary or chic, you may want to consider white cabinets with stainless steel hardware. White cabinets help keep the room bright and airy while still maintaining a sophisticated look.

Additionally, stainless steel hardware will add a modern edge to your design.

For those looking for something more unique, consider pairing white appliances with bold colors such as navy blue or hunter green. This combination is sure to make your kitchen stand out from the rest! As an added bonus, these colors can help hide dirt and fingerprints that might accumulate over time.

Finally, if you want to create a classic look while still keeping things light and airy, consider using gray cabinets paired with white appliances. The cool tones of gray will provide an elegant backdrop while still maintaining an inviting atmosphere.
